Position Overview

The Department Manager General Merchandise (GM) manages the General Merchandise department at a large store, including managing employee activities to meet the financial and marketing objectives of the company. Coordinates sales promotions with the Home Office and manages execution in the store. This position also assists customers and suggests the selection of products based on knowledge of current products, familiarity with offerings, and customer interactions. Demonstrates strong knowledge of Follett systems and strategies (Included Program, Academic Tools, System Integrations, etc.), the industry, and the competitive landscape to execute initiatives, drive profitable sales, and control expenses. Effectively executes company programs and initiatives. Ensures compliance with company policies and procedures. Partners with various support partners, including Store Operations, RCMS, AP, HR, and Training. Consistently demonstrates Follett Values - Integrity, Accountability, Customers, Each and Every Associate, Innovation, and Teamwork. Demonstrates proficiency in Follett Strategic Competencies.

Responsibilities

  • Supervises the employees of the department, including assigning and evaluating work as well as interviewing, hiring, and training new employees.
  • Supervises the Home Office-regulated Return-to-Vendor (RTV) receiving and scanning processes.
  • Assists customers in finding products.
  • Manages the special order functions and notifies customers.
  • Partners to create and maintain a Hassle Free customer service culture, focused on solutions-based selling and an exceptional customer experience.
  • Builds key partnerships with other store staff and campus organizations for promotional and special events and assists with off-site sales opportunities (e.g., graduation, basketball, football, author signings, etc.).
  • Conducts store walkthroughs daily to ensure proper stock levels, inventory placement, and customer service levels.
  • Manages the in-store merchandise display from the stockroom to the sales floor, serving as the liaison between the Store and the Planner.
  • Creates and maintains displays in compliance with company standards.
  • Executes Home Office-initiated markups and markdowns, analyzes financial reports, processes purchase orders, and approves invoices.
  • Partners with the Store Manager to execute promotions and sales and ensures proper inventory levels based on sales and trends.
  • May perform website maintenance and fill orders. Maintains price accuracy and merchandise availability on the store website.
  • Responds to student, faculty, staff, alumni, and other customer questions and issues resolving escalated issues as necessary.
  • May manage the store in the store manager's absence or occasionally supervise other departments.
  • May open or close the store.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
